Description

A glazed UPVC front door opens to the central ENTRANCE HALL with LVT flooring fitted with underfloor heating which continues through to Lounge and Kitchen Diner, with wall-mounted and ceiling-integrated lights and half-turn carpeted stairs rising to the first floor with natural light drawn in from a side window over. A practical WC lies just off with stylish, part-tiled walls, modern WC, wall-hung sink with vanity storage and frosted window to the front.The accommodation continues to a front DINING ROOM with fitted carpet, central ceiling light and large window to the front. A door connects into a private SITTING / TV ROOM with laid carpet, central ceiling light and window with views to the front.To the rear lies a highly sociable and airy KITCHEN / BREAKFAST / LIVING ROOM with a continuation of the LVT flooring throughout the space.A solid painted oak fitted KITCHEN / BREAKFAST space hosts a run of wall and base-mounted cabinetry with integrated downlighting and countertops over. A complementing breakfast bar peninsula with lighting over is a sociable spot. Integrated appliances include a wine cooler, dishwasher, 'Bosch' gas hob, double oven, microwave oven and 'Neff' coffee machine.A sizeable LIVING ROOM open to the kitchen offers a great family space to relax with feature inset wood burner with decorative surround and shuttered, bi-fold doors linking the house and south-facing garden seamlessly.A plumbed BOOT ROOM and separate utility room is accessible off the kitchen with ceramic tiled flooring, wall-mounted sink with rear garden access via a part-glazed door and internal access to the utility/laundry room.The UTILITY ROOM has natural light from an obscured glazed window with plumbed provision for white goods under a wood-effect countertop, heated airing electric tubes and drying rails with access to the wall-mounted Worcester boiler.To the first floor, off a generous carpeted landing that takes in elevated, scenic views across Vale countryside, lie three double bedroom suites.BEDROOM 1 is a large double bedroom with fitted carpet and a large window with a rear garden aspect. In addition, fitted wardrobes with a range of hanging rails and storage options. A beautifully appointed en-suite bathroom is a luxurious addition, comprising sandstone tiling with accent lighting, modern WC, side-by-side double sinks and a striking central double-ended bath with a large walk-in shower behind.BEDROOM 2 is a rear garden-facing double bedroom with fitted carpet, built-in double wardrobe and access to EN-SUITE SHOWER ROOM.The tiled EN-SUITE SHOWER ROOM comprises a walk-in shower, modern WC, vanity hand basin and inset ceiling lighting.BEDROOM 3 is a double bedroom that lies to the front of the property with part-pitched ceilings and fitted carpet that enjoys far-ranging rolling countryside views, with an en-suite shower room accessible.The fully tiled EN-SUITE SHOWER ROOM has been neutrally decorated with mains-fed shower enclosure, modern WC and vanity hand basin with frosted window drawing natural light in from the side elevation.A quarter-turn carpeted stairs from the first floor rises to the carpeted second floor landing with access to double bedrooms 4, 5 and shower room.BEDROOMS 4 AND 5 are double bedrooms with fitted carpet and eaves storage access. BEDROOM 4 benefits from inset lighting and a Velux window to the ceiling. BEDROOM 5 is a naturally bright room with Velux window and side window drawing in an abundance of light.Rounding off the internal accommodation is a stylish SHOWER ROOM with tiled walls and a suite comprising a hand basin, low-level WC and shower enclosure.To the front, a sizeable block-pavia driveway provides parking for numerous vehicles comfortably, with an established stocked shrub bed on the approach to the front entrance. Wide steps rise gradually to the front door.Secure double-gated access with pavia pathway leads to the southerly-aspect, landscaped rear garden. A large seating area with electrically operated awning over extends to a well-kept grass lawn with planted borders and log/bin store accessible. To the far end of the plot lies a sizeable timber-built outbuilding with double GARAGE, WORKSHOP, WC and BAR within.The GARAGE is accessed via a barn-style double door with power and lighting present, with additional parking if necessary. An internal door connects into a plumbed WC and also gives secondary access to the BAR, which is primarily accessed off a single wooden door from the garden.The BAR has a double-height vaulted wood-panelled ceiling and walls with power and lighting.A truly versatile space — this could lend itself to a home office, studio or business space, if required.
